基于主成分分析的洱海北部入湖河流水质评价及变化趋势研究
Study on Water Quality Assessment and Variation Tendency About Northern Rivers of Erhai Lake Based on Principal Component Analysis

The water quality of nine monitoring points of the northern three rivers(Miju River,Yong'an River and Luoshi River)of Erhai Lake from 2015 to 2022 was synthetically analyzed with the Principal Component Analysis(PCA)method.The comprehensive score was calculated according to the analysis of each component,and the main influencing indicators were analyzed to study the spatial variation characteristics and temporal variation trend of water quality,so as to provide a basis for pollution prevention and water ecological environment protection and comprehensive treatment in the northern Erhai Lake.The results indicated that the main pollution was organic contaminants in the northern three main rivers of Erhai Lake.The water quality of Miju River was better than Yongan River and Luoshi River according to the synthetic assessment method of PCA.It appeared that descendant tendency about synthetic score of three northern main rivers of Erhai Lake from 2015 to 2022.This indicated that the contaminated load of water quality decreased by year.The water quality of three northern rivers of Erhai Lake was evidently improved from 2021 to 2022.关键词
